What is ERP Consulting?

ERP consulting is a service provided by professional consultants who specialize in helping businesses select, implement, and optimize their ERP systems. These consultants work with businesses to identify their unique needs, assess existing systems and processes, and provide recommendations for ERP solutions that can improve their operations.

ERP consulting firms typically offer a range of services, including ERP system selection, implementation planning, project management, data migration, training, and ongoing support.

The Benefits of ERP Consulting

Expertise: ERP consulting firms have extensive experience and expertise in selecting and implementing ERP systems. They can provide valuable insights into best practices and industry standards, as well as help identify potential pitfalls and solutions.

  • Cost Savings: ERP consulting firms can help businesses identify and avoid costly mistakes during implementation. They can also help negotiate better pricing for software and services.
  • Increased Efficiency: ERP consulting firms can help businesses streamline their processes, eliminate redundancies, and automate tasks. This can lead to improved efficiency and productivity.
  • Improved Decision-Making: ERP systems provide businesses with real-time data and insights into their operations. ERP consulting firms can help businesses optimize their systems to provide the most useful information, enabling better decision-making.
  • Scalability: As businesses grow, their ERP systems must be able to scale with them. ERP consulting firms can help businesses choose and implement scalable systems that can adapt to changing needs.

Choosing the Right ERP Consulting Firm

When choosing an ERP consulting firm, it's important to consider their experience, expertise, and approach. Here are some key factors to look for:

  • Industry Experience: Look for an ERP consulting firm that has experience working with businesses in your industry. They will have a better understanding of your unique needs and challenges.
  • Expertise: Look for consultants with expertise in the specific ERP system you are considering. They should also have experience with related systems and technologies.
  • Proven Track Record: Look for an ERP consulting firm with a proven track record of successful ERP implementations. They should be able to provide references and case studies.
  • Project Management: Look for a firm with strong project management skills. They should have a clear implementation plan and be able to manage the project from start to finish.
  • Communication: Look for a firm with clear and open communication. They should be able to explain technical concepts in simple terms and provide regular updates on project progress.
